It's happened again.
Days after Joel Ward of the Washington Capitals stunned the New York Rangers with a literal last-second goal, Tyler Johnson replicated the feat to give the Tampa Bay Lightning a Game 3 win over the Montreal Canadiens.
The goal, Johnson's playoff-leading eighth, came as everyone was about to head to the fridge for some overtime refreshments.
And with that, the Conn Smythe buzz continues to grow.
